CLEAN WATER MANAGEMENT TRUST FUND BOARD CONSIDERS LAND PROJECTS AT MEETING AT BROWNS SUMMIT

RALEIGH -- The 21-member board of the Clean Water Management Trust Fund meets September 9-10 in Alamance County to consider grant applications for land acquisition projects to protect water quality across the state.

The meeting will take place at The Summit at Haw River State Park, 339 Conference Center Drive, Browns Summit, beginning with board committee meetings at 11:00 a.m. on Sunday, September 9. The full board will meet Monday,September 10, beginning at 9:00 a.m. at The Summit.

Before the board are some 60 requests for approximately $40 million in water quality grants for acqusition projects in communities all across the state. The grant requests were submitted for consideration on March 1, 2007.

In addtion to consideration of grant requests, Director of State Parks Lewis Ledford, and Commissioner of Agriculture and Consumer Services Steve Troxler will address the trustees.   The board will also be provided an update on the conservation efforts along the Haw River and the Haw River Trail.

The CWMTF was established 1996 to help finance projects that enhance or restore degraded waters, protect unpolluted waters, and/or contribute toward a network of riparian buffers and greenways for environmental, educational, and recreational benefits.

CWMTF estimates that over $17 billion is needed to protect and restore water quality in North Carolina.

The independent, CWMTF Board of Trustees has full responsibility over the allocation of moneys from the Fund.
